Sinapis was one of the first organizations in Africa focused on entrepreneurial acceleration. Today, we continue to help ambitious founders build enduring businesses through practical acceleration, integrated capital, and trusted long-term relationships.

Built by entrepreneurs, for entrepreneurs

Designed by entrepreneurs for entrepreneurs, Sinapis offers accelerators built for the realities of running and growing a business in frontier markets. Our alumni have created more than 16,000 jobs and raised over $120 million in capital. Eighty-eight percent of companies are still operating three years after completing a Sinapis accelerator.

Founders recommend Sinapis to others because the experience is holistic and grounded in real-world business challenges. In our alumni survey, 66% reported learning something through Sinapis that helped save their business from failure.
